Horizon Flevoland is the regional development agency for the Flevoland province, supporting foreign and local entrepreneurs through internationalization, capital financing, and business development programs from its headquarters in Lelystad, Netherlands. The agency facilitates foreign direct investment, provides loans and subsidies, and manages funds like the €13.3 million TMI Proof of Concept Fund Flevoland, promoting innovation in sustainable sectors such as food and aviation. Led by CEO Marco Smit and supported by Regional Minister Jan Klopman, Horizon Flevoland partners with organizations including StartLife and the Province of Flevoland. Its portfolio includes investments in companies like NRG2fly, which received funding in 2024 for expanding electric plane charging networks, and Viroteq, co-funded in 2020 for its prototype. Horizon Flevoland was established in 1996; its founders are not publicly known.
